Due to the increased use of e-loans and e-docs, Calyx has integrated a document image storage feature for organizing and storing all of the documents in each Point file. Point automatically encrypts, compresses and associates each document with the loan file, regardless of whether the document is single or one of a group, from within Point or one of its interfaces, or from outside of Point. Externally-generated documents can be scanned and imported, or dragged and dropped, into the Point file, while maintaining an audit trail for each document that shows who created it, what it contains, and the date and time it was created. PointCentral provides all the benefits and functionality of the Point program; but also allows remote users to access all loan documentation via a secured Internet connection and gives customers the ability to apply field-level rules and conditions for quality and compliance purposes.
